08.11.2007 - Source:
Guardian
"State of emergency in Georgia"
President Saakashvili announces 15-day state of emergency as violent protests against him spark clashes with police; at least 500 wounded; tear gas and water cannons in use; state forces take independent TV stations off air; government claims measures necessary to avoid a coup [ID 85557]
|
08.11.2007 - Source:
Guardian
"Georgia president calls election"
President Mikhail Saakashvili calls for early elections; elections will be held in January 2008 instead of late 2008; police units patrol streets of Tbilisi in order to secure state of emergency [ID 85584]
